揭示大趋势情景,驾驭“分裂世界”

日期:2025年2月19日

了解地缘政治紧张局势和民粹主义如何影响未来增长前景,以及为什么这对您的企业和全球经济至关重要。加入我们的独家网络研讨会,了解我们的全新大趋势情景服务(Megatrends Scenarios),探索“分裂世界”情景对经济的影响。
